
Tuition fees master's
On this page you can find information on the amount of tuition fees you have to pay. How you would like to pay can be indicated via Studielink.
Are you a European student*?
Your tuition fee for the academic year 2022-2023 is €2209.
Your tuition fee for the academic year 2023-2024 is €2314.
*Students with a nationality from NL/EEA/SME¹ countries are considered European students.
Are you a non-EU student**?
Then your tuition fee for the academic year 2022-2023 is €18.700
Then your tuition fee for the academic year 2023-2024 is €19.600
**Students with a nationality other than from NL/EEA/SME¹ countries are considered NON-EU students.

Exceptions
Are you studying a second master's programme?
The amount of tuition fee 2022-2023 for a second (online) master's programme is €13.250 for NL/EEA/SME1 students (institutional tuition fee 2). Non-NL/EEA/SME1 students pay institutional tuition fee 3 for a second master's (€18.700).
Note: if your enrolment for the first master's overlaps with your second master's for at least one month (or more), you do not need to pay the institutional tuition fee 2. Then either the statutory fee or institutional tuition fee 3 applies to you.
NL/EEA/SME1 students who take part in a part-time online master's programme 2022-2023 as a second master's pay €7.290. Non-NL/EEA/SME1 students who take part in a part-time online master's programme pay institutional tuition fee 3 (€10.285).
Do you start your second master's and does it overlap for at least 1 month with your enrolment in your first master's, then you will pay statutory tuition fee as a NL/EEA/SME1 student. As a non-NL/EEA/SME1 student with both the first and second master's at WUR you do not have to pay tuition fees for the 2nd master's as long as you are not finished with your 1st master's. After graduation in the first master's you will pay institutional tuition fee 3 for the second master's.
Are you studying a part-time online master's programme?
As a NL/EEA/SME1 student you will pay €2209 for 2022-2023. If this is your second master's programme you will pay €7.290 as a NL/EEA/SME1 student. As a non-NL/EEA/SME1 student you will pay €10.285. Are you studying the Joint Degree Master Water Technology?
As a non-NL/EEA/SME1 student you pay the lowest institutional tuition fee of the participating universities. You will pay €15.166 for the academic year 2021-2022. The same applies if you started your studies in the cohort 2019 or 2020. If you started in 2018 or before you need to pay €13.916 for the academic year 2021-2022.
Is this your second master and are you a NL/EEA/SME1 student? You need to pay €12.166.
The fee for 2022-2023 still need to be determined.
